63871167227595 is an odd compos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four hundred thirty-two divisors.

Prime factorization of 63871167227595:

3 × 5 × 7 × 132 × 232 × 892 × 859

(3 × 5 × 7 × 13 × 13 × 23 × 23 × 89 × 89 × 859)
